What is a subdomain?


An additional area in your website is known as a subdomain. You could choose to use a subdomain if you think you want to expand your website with a new area that strengthens your brand. Your e-commerce store may even be linked to this subdomain, which enables you to give users more information.


Consider the case of Google. Along with "maps.google.com" and "earth.google.com," there is Google's primary search engine, "google.com." Despite the fact that both are still a part of the main Google website, they serve different functions. Subdomains are subcategories beneath Google if Google is the main umbrella.


They are made for a variety of purposes, such as:


  • Improve the website's content layout

  • Give more information about a particular subject

  • Boost domain authority and SEO

  • Make the most of geo-targeted pages

  • Establish a unique online store


The following 5 ways subdomain affect SEO


A company can decide to create a subdomain primarily in an effort to improve the effectiveness of its SEO strategy. Here are 5 scenarios that could occur:


1. Improved on-site experience


By employing a subdomain, you can provide visitors on your main website an alternative user experience. Your subdomain is often an expansion of your main website when you want to go deeper into a particular subject but don't want this content on your main website.


Users will have an easier time finding the information they need on your website thanks to this method of content organisation. Because of the improved on-site experience, you will rank higher in search engine results (SERP).


2. Targets international markets


As mentioned, a subdomain can be used to create specialised content. With your subdomain content, you can target particular regions and countries. This is fantastic if your business is global and you want to concentrate on international markets. This suggests that your SEO ranking in such countries may be higher if you have a specific subdomain devoted to targeting that country.


3. Makes your URL keyword-rich


SEO and keywords go hand in hand. Potential customers will be able to find you more readily by searching for your product or service if your website is associated with such keywords. 


It can be challenging to incorporate keywords in your website's primary URL if your company name, like Apple, for example, doesn't necessarily correspond to your products. You may tie in keywords that are pertinent to your site with a subdomain URL, which is a terrific opportunity for you to raise your SEO ranks for those keywords.

4. Aids in building authority in specialised markets


Your subdomain's level of generality or specificity is up to you. Subdomains are frequently created to be more customised in order to target markets that the primary website may not be able to reach. This might be a great SEO tactic for businesses trying to grow their authority and traffic from those more specific regions.


5. Increases the site's domain authority


Domain authority describes how people view your website. It's a software as a service (SaaS) score created by Moz for search engine rankings. The domain authority (DA) of a website is scaled from 1-100. In general, a site with a higher DA is considered to be more trustworthy and often ranks higher in search engines.
